Understanding Six Sigma Green Belt Solutions

What is a Six Sigma Green Belt?

A Six Sigma Green Belt is an individual trained in the fundamental principles of Six Sigma methodology, equipped to lead process improvement projects and assist Black Belts in larger initiatives. Green Belts typically work part-time on Six Sigma projects, applying statistical tools and problem-solving techniques to achieve measurable improvements. Their solutions focus on identifying root causes of problems, reducing defects, and ensuring sustainable quality enhancements.

Core Components of Green Belt Solutions

Define Phase

In this initial phase, Green Belts articulate the problem statement, set project goals, and define the scope. Clear problem definitions help align teams and set expectations. Typical tools include:

  • Project Charter
  • Voice of the Customer (VOC)
  • SIPOC diagrams (Suppliers, Inputs, Process, Outputs, Customers)

Measure Phase

This phase involves data collection and process measurement to establish baseline performance. Key activities include:

  • Data collection planning
  • Process mapping
  • Measurement system analysis
  • Descriptive statistics

Tools such as control charts and process capability analysis are commonly used to assess current process performance.

Analyze Phase

Here, Green Belts identify root causes of variability and defects through statistical analysis. Techniques include:

  • Pareto analysis
  • Fishbone diagrams (Ishikawa)
  • Hypothesis testing
  • Correlation and regression analysis

The goal is to pinpoint factors contributing to process issues.

Improve Phase

Solutions are developed and tested during this stage. Green Belts implement process changes, pilot improvements, and validate effectiveness. Techniques include:

  • Brainstorming and idea generation
  • Design of Experiments (DOE)
  • Failure Mode and Effects Analysis (FMEA)
  • Pilot testing and implementation planning

Control Phase

Ensuring sustainability of improvements is critical. Green Belts establish control plans, monitor process performance, and document procedures. Tools such as control charts and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) help maintain gains over time.

Key Tools and Techniques in Green Belt Solutions

Statistical Process Control (SPC)

SPC involves monitoring process behavior through control charts to detect variations and maintain stability. Green Belts use control charts like X-bar and R charts to track process performance.

Root Cause Analysis

Identifying the fundamental cause of problems is essential. Techniques include:

  • Fishbone diagrams
  • 5 Whys analysis
  • Pareto charts

Design of Experiments (DOE)

DOE allows Green Belts to determine the relationships between factors affecting a process, optimizing performance while reducing variability.

FMEA (Failure Mode and Effects Analysis)

FMEA helps identify potential failure modes, assess their severity, and prioritize corrective actions.

Process Mapping and Value Stream Mapping

Visual tools like process maps and value stream maps provide insights into process flow, waste, and bottlenecks, guiding improvement efforts.
